容器轻应用平台

  • 容器轻应用平台 > 快速入门 > 新手指南

    新手指南

    最近更新时间: 2022-11-10 14:10:59

    1. 什么是容器轻应用平台?

    容器轻应用平台(QAPP),是一款面向开发者的容器应用服务,为您的数据处理业务提供稳定、可靠、按需弹性缩放的容器运行服务。为您省去底层服务器的运维和管理工作,专注于业务开发,提升开发效率。同时,只需要为容器实际运行消耗的资源付费,可以节约使用成本。

    本文将帮助您快速了解容器轻应用平台(QAPP),您可根据指引快速上手QAPP。

    2. 了解QAPP的计费

    七牛云容器轻应用平台,会按照用户实例实际使用情况收取费用。关于收费模式和具体价格,请参阅 购买指南-计费说明

    3.QAPP 使用流程图

    QAPP 使用流程如下图所示。

    image

    1. 在首次部署应用前,需要完成注册、认证、制作应用镜像、配置应用版本(应用多版本可以模拟出测试、生产的不同阶段,方便后续进行版本升级)等准备工作。

    2. 在QAPP控制台部署实例。

      具体操作,请参见部署管理。除通过控制台部署应用外,还支持通过 命令行工具 qappctl 来部署应用。

    3. 通过以下方式访问应用。

      • 方式一:访问 kodo 资源。具体操作,请参见Fop请求入口
      • 方式二:访问公网资源。具体操作,请参见异步任务入口
      • 同时可以设置更细粒度的访问权限控制,请提交工单申请。
    4. 可选:您可以为 QAPP 应用配置更多进阶功能。

      • 弹性(降本增效)
      • 可观测性
      • 流量管理

    4.使用QAPP 服务

    4.1 注册与认证

    在使用七牛云QAPP服务之前,您需要七牛账号,并完成 实名认证

    4.2 部署应用

    您可参考 快速部署一个应用实例 文档,了解快速创建应用实例的方法。

    4.3 应用托管

    QAPP 作为集群、应用、存储、流量等模块的管理平台,如果您需获取更多信息或需进行更多实践操作,请参考以下内容进一步了解并使用。

    如果您想管理实例生命周期 可以阅读
    上传本地可运行的 docker image到应用镜像仓库。 命令行工具 qappctl
    创建应用版本,方便在不同区域进行实例部署。 应用版本
    业务需要配置很多文本或环境变量,当配置发生变更时,避免额外的代码修改和镜像构建。 应用配置
    对已创建的应用中部署实例。 部署实例
    手动扩缩适用于人工运维的场景,针对服务流量不多的情况。 手动扩缩
    设置定时扩缩或指标扩缩来实现自动扩缩容,从容应对业务突发流量。 自动扩缩
    对运行中的应用实例,可以通过滚动更新的方式升级,如果发生异常,可以回滚。 滚动更新
    应用借助流量分配可以实现流量切分,A/B 测试等高级功能。 流量控制
    对存储在七牛云上的文件,通过构建的数据处理框架来执行数据处理操作。 Fop请求入口
    实现了访问公网,通过分配的域名,创建对应 HTTP 接口的异步调用。 异步任务入口
    如果您想监控诊断应用运行情况 可以阅读
    应用运行过程中,提供实时的标准输出日志,方便定位排查业务问题。 日志查询
    应用运行过程中,方便了解启用实例的运行情况和健康状态等信息。 监控中心
    应用运行过程中,当应用触发告警规则时自动发送告警通知,快速发现应用运行异常。 告警
    以上内容是否对您有帮助?
  • Qvm free helper
    Close